Calgary Fire Department to Deploy Mobile Records Management
New system compliant with Canadian and U.S. reporting standards
The Calgary Fire Department (CFD) recently purchased records management software. The new software allows firefighters to report on incidents more quickly, track business license inspections, establish and report on fire prevention procedures, preplan for emergency responses, and analyze fire department efficiency
"We view the FireRMS product as the core of our Fire Information System," said Joe Puglia, Calgary's fire information system coordinator. "Most of our data will be housed within this product, and it will, therefore, be the central source of our reporting to the province, city council, media, and others."
The new system is fully compliant with the Alberta Incident Reporting standards as well as the Ontario Fire Marshal reporting system and the United States Fire Administration's National Fire Incident Reporting System (NFIRS 5.0). All three support nation-wide and province-wide data collection and analysis to improve the safety of citizens and emergency personnel. To add to the rich data set that makes this level of compliance possible, Calgary initiated BIO-key's development of the FireRMS 5.0 Occupancy Load Tracking and Reporting functionality. This allows firefighters to track the capacity of distinct locations to further enhance public safety.
